Four more area-wide lease sales are required within ten years
What the document says“the Secretary shall conduct not fewer than 4 lease sales area-wide under the oil and gas program by not later than 10 years after the date of enactment of this Act.”
The section requires at least four area-wide lease sales under the oil and gas program within ten years of enactment, on top of the sales already required by section 20001(c)(1)(A) of Public Law 115-97, offering the same terms and conditions as the record of decision described in the Bureau of Land Management notice at 85 Fed. Reg. 51754. Existing rules on rights-of-way and surface development under that law apply to the new leases.
